HomeMy WebLinkAbout07/29/1930F~ETURN OF MEETING OF THE QUALIFIED VOTERS 0F MATTITUOK FIRE DISTRICT, IN THE TOWN OF SGUTHOLD, SUFi~OLK COUNTY, NEW YORK, HELD ON THE 29th DAY OF JULY, 1930. We, the undersigned, the Chairman, Inspector and Clerk duly appointed to act at a meeting of the qualified voters of the Mattituck Fire District in the Town of Southold, Suffolk County, New York, held at the Mattituck Fire House in the Village of Mattituck, in said District, on the 29th day of. July, 1930, do hereby make the following return of said meeting: The meeting was open fr~n ? to 9 o'clock P. M. Daylight Saving Time, as stated in the call of the meeting and the nameS of all persons voting thereat were recorded; that printed ballots were used and samples were provided for free and con- fidential examination by all persons attending said meeting; tl,~t locked box was used in which the ballots were placed as vote~ and at the s-me time the names of the voters were recorded on the voting list; that said box was not unlocked or lm*astened ~ntil the close of the meeting, and when opened the ballots Were counted and the number thereof was compared with the na~e~ ecorded as having voted and it was found ballots had been voted:- ~ The canvass of said ballots was as follows:- On the question "Shall the Fire Comm~ssioners of said Mattituck Fire District, Southold Town, Suffolk County, New ~ork, be authorized, empowered and directed to expend the sum ~wenty Thousand Dollars or so much thereof as may be necessary ;o erect upon a site located in said district, a suitable fire- ~roof building for a fire house to house the fire apparatus of ~aid district and to provide meeting rooms and other facilities pequired in connection therewith and shall the sum of Twenty ThOusand Dollars be raised by the levy of a tax by installment said tax to be sufficient for the payment of bonds hereinafterl ~described and the interest thereon when the same shall be pay-! able and shall bonds in the sum of Twenty Thousand Dollars be ~ issued and payable as follows: Twenty bonds to be in the de- ,nomination of One Thousand Dollars each, the first of which ishall be due and payable o~ the 1st day of August, 1931, and lone bond shall be due and payable on the 1st day of August in each suceeding year until said bonds b~ve been fully paid, said ~bonds to bear interest at the rate of Four and Three-Quarters i!,(A~%) per cent, to be paid semi,annually on the 1st day of IPebruary and August in each year when it shall become due?" That thereupon, we signed this return in duplicate and delivered one to the Town Clerk of the Town of Southold, ~uffolk County, New York, together with the said ballots and ~he list of the names of the persons voting at said meeting; bhe other we delivered to tho Fire Commissioners of said Dis- ~trict. ~)ated August 1, 1930.
